About The Position

The Grants Coordinator plays a key role in the success of JVS’s institutional giving portfolio by ensuring proposals, reports, deadlines, and materials move smoothly from planning to submission. This role supports the grants team by managing grant portals, preparing attachments, maintaining accurate records across systems, and helping ensure all submissions are complete, timely, and well-organized. This is an ideal role for someone who is detail-oriented, curious, and eager to grow in the nonprofit sector, who enjoys using organization, project management, and collaboration to support economic mobility for hundreds of Californians. This role will report to the Director of Grants Strategy for an initial period before transitioning to report directly to the Grants Manager.

Responsibilities

  • Manage grant portal activity, ensuring applications, reports, budgets, and attachments are uploaded accurately and submitted on time
  • Create, maintain, and update proposal checklists, submission calendars, and funder files
  • Prepare standard attachments (board lists, financial statements, organizational documents) and coordinate with Finance and Operations to ensure accuracy
  • Track and collect required materials from internal teams and proactively follow up on outstanding requests
  • Support quality assurance by reviewing proposals for completeness, formatting, consistency, and compliance with funder guidelines
  • Draft select administrative-facing components of grant applications and reports, including organizational descriptions, program overviews, and boilerplate language
  • Maintain and update JVS’s grants content library, including templates, attachments, and standard language.
  • Enter and maintain accurate grant records in Salesforce, SharePoint, LastPass, and related systems
  • Run basic reports to support tracking of submissions, deadlines, and progress toward team goals
  • Support data pulls and coordination with internal teams to ensure proposals reflect accurate and current information
  • Assist the grants team as we research, develop, and refine AI tools that improve efficiency, accuracy, and workflow.
  • Partner with Program, Marketing, Finance, and other teams to ensure grant materials reflect current programming, outcomes, and accurate budgets
  • Support team effectiveness through participation in meetings, funder preparation sessions, post-submission debriefs, and preparation of briefing materials
  • Recommend process improvements and help maintain organized, accessible funder records and communications
  • Proactively follow up with staff to keep grants-related requests moving forward.
